Takerō Oiji (March 21, 1926 - July 14, 1980) was a Japanese scholar of medieval English literature. Born in Hiroshima, he was the son of Lieutenant Colonel Takezō Oiji. He graduated from Tohoku University's Faculty of Literature in 1951 and held positions as a lecturer at Yamagata University, an associate professor at Tohoku University, and a professor at Sophia University. He received the Japanese Translation Culture Award in 1974 for his work 'The Farmer's Dream as Seen by Williams.'
